10 Tips for Applying for a HELOC Without Proof of Income

Applying for a Home Equity Line of Credit (HELOC) can be a great way to tap into the equity in your home for major expenses. However, traditional lenders typically require proof of income to qualify for a HELOC. If you're self-employed, retired, or have irregular income, this can pose a challenge. Fortunately, there are options available for applying for a HELOC without proof of income. Here are 10 tips to help you navigate this process:

  1. Research alternative lenders: Some lenders specialize in providing HELOCs to borrowers without traditional proof of income requirements. Look for lenders who offer stated income HELOCs or bank statement HELOCs.
  2. Build a strong credit history: Lenders may be more willing to overlook income requirements if you have a solid credit history. Make sure your credit score is in good shape before applying for a HELOC.
  3. Provide documentation of assets: If you have significant assets, such as savings, investments, or real estate, be prepared to provide documentation to demonstrate your financial stability.
  4. Consider a co-signer: If you have a family member or friend with a steady income and good credit, you may be able to qualify for a HELOC by having them co-sign the loan.
  5. Offer a larger down payment: Some lenders may be willing to overlook income requirements if you can make a larger down payment on the loan. Consider saving up extra cash to put towards your HELOC.
  6. Prepare a detailed business plan: If you're self-employed, a detailed business plan can help demonstrate your financial stability and ability to repay the loan.
  7. Seek out non-traditional lenders: In addition to traditional banks and credit unions, consider alternative lenders such as online lenders or peer-to-peer lending platforms.
  8. Be prepared to pay a higher interest rate: Lenders may charge a higher interest rate for HELOCs without proof of income, so be prepared for potentially higher costs.
  9. Consider a home equity loan instead: If you're unable to qualify for a HELOC without proof of income, a home equity loan may be a viable alternative. With a home equity loan, you receive a lump sum of cash upfront and make fixed monthly payments over a set term.
  10. Consult with a financial advisor: A financial advisor can help you explore your options and determine the best course of action for accessing the equity in your home without traditional proof of income.

By following these tips and doing your research, you can increase your chances of successfully applying for a HELOC without proof of income. Remember to carefully review the terms and conditions of any loan offer before signing on the dotted line.
